Promising KWS Opener Goes South for Sean Watts

PETERSEN MEDIA: After taking his lumps and acclimating to some off season changes while running with the World of Outlaws, Sean Watts kicked his 2018 King of the West campaign off Sunday in Bakersfield, CA and after getting off to a nice start a lap five mistake would bring his night to an early end.

“I thought we were really good all night long, and it made some of those long nights with the Outlaws worth it,” Sean Watts said. “Unfortunately I pushed the issue a little to hard on the fifth lap and got upside down and ended our night, but like I said I was really happy with the speed and fell of the racecar.”

Waiting an extra day to kick off the 2018 King of the West season, the curtain went up on Sunday at Kern County Raceway Park with 22 fire breathing 410’s checked into the pit area.

Timing the Grizzly Coolers/Schaeffer Racing Oil/Rolfe Construction backed No. 98 entry in ninth fastest in qualifying time trials, the Atwater, CA pilot would pocket a third place finish in his heat race.

With a new points structure in place in 2018 to make up the Dash cars, Watts would come up short on being eligible and would line up in the ninth starting position for the 30-lap feature event.

When the green flag was displayed to the field, Watts would take advantage of being in the bottom groove and would work into the eighth spot before taking over seventh on the third circuit.

Running comfortably in the Top-10, Watts would battle for sixth on the fifth lap but would get into the corner a little too hot and it would result in him getting the Billet America/Varni Electric/Kaeding Performance backed entry upside down and ending his night.

Watts would be credited with a 21st place finish.

“It is definitely not how I wanted my night to end, but we put it behind us and look forward to the next one,” Watts said. “Hopefully we can keep making progress and getting better and better each night. Thanks to everyone for their hard work.”
